N.T. Wright
N.T. Wright is a prominent British New Testament scholar, theologian, and author known for his work on the historical Jesus and Christian origins. He has served as the Bishop of Durham and is a prolific writer, contributing significantly to contemporary Christian thought.

1. The New Testament And The People Of God
Christian Origins and the Question of God, Volume 1
This scholarly work delves into the historical and cultural contexts of early Christianity, exploring the intricate relationship between the New Testament writings and the Jewish and Greco-Roman worlds. It examines the socio-political landscape of the time, offering insights into how these factors influenced the formation and interpretation of Christian texts. The book also discusses the theological implications of these findings, providing a comprehensive framework for understanding the origins and development of early Christian thought and practice.
